MOBKL2B Rabbit Polyclonal Antibody (BF594)

MOBKL2B Rabbit Polyclonal Antibody (BF594) is a BF594 conjugated antibody targeting MOB3B. This antibody is suitable for IF. It exhibits reactivity with Mouse samples.
